Overview
The quickbooks-mcp server connects Claude to QuickBooks data through a direct REST API, enabling natural language queries for financial reports and operations. It addresses QuickBooks UI limitations, such as buried P&L data and multi-click access to overdue invoices, by providing structured API endpoints.
Key Capabilities
Free tier (6 tools):
- P&L: Retrieves profit and loss statements.
- unpaid invoices: Lists outstanding invoices.
- overdue clients: Identifies clients with overdue payments.
- invoice list: Fetches all invoices.
- vendors: Queries vendor data.
- expense categories: Lists expense categories.
Paid tier ($19/mo, 9 tools):
- expense breakdown: Details expenses by category.
- cash flow: Generates cash flow reports.
- create invoices: Creates new invoices.
- record payments: Logs payments received.
- bills: Manages bill data.
- balances: Checks account balances.
- AI anomaly detection: Detects unusual financial patterns.
- AI cashflow forecast: Predicts future cash flows.
- AI financial health: Assesses overall financial status.
